Amaneciendo


Amaneciendo is the thirteenth studio album by Camilo Sesto. The first audio Cassette was released in 1980. The album contains two of his most successful singles of his career; beginning with, "Perdóname", a coded ballad dedicated to his mother, as well as "Donde Estés Con Quien Estés", which reached No. 1 in Spain and Latin America. It has broken records for selling more than 10 million copies in less than a year.
"Perdóname" ranked on the Billboard Top 40 for 18 consecutive weeks. In addition, "Donde Estés Con Quien Estés", "Un Amor No Muere Así Como Así", "Días De Vino y De Rosas", "Vivir Sin Ti", and "Samba" had their first place in some countries that were published as singles.
